The Landscape of African Shops in Chicago
African shops in Chicago come in various forms, each reflecting the unique cultures and traditions of the numerous African nations represented in the city. These shops can be categorized into several types:
- Traditional African Markets: These markets often feature a wide range of products, from handmade crafts to traditional clothing and textiles.
- Specialty Stores: Focused on specific items such as African art, jewelry, and home decor, these shops cater to customers looking for unique treasures.
- Grocery Stores: African grocery stores sell imported food items, spices, and ingredients that are essential for preparing traditional African dishes.
- Online Shops: Many African artisans and businesses have embraced e-commerce, allowing customers to access unique products from the comfort of their homes.
Types of Unique Treasures to Discover
Visiting African shops in Chicago is akin to embarking on a treasure hunt. The items found in these stores are often handcrafted and carry deep cultural significance. Below are some of the unique treasures you can discover:
1. Handcrafted Art and Sculptures
The African shops in Chicago often showcase intricate sculptures and artwork created by local and international artisans. These pieces range from wooden carvings to metal sculptures that embody the rich artistic heritage of the African continent.
2. Traditional Textiles
Textiles are an essential aspect of African culture, and many shops offer vibrant fabrics, clothing, and accessories. Look for items such as kente cloth, mud cloth, and batik prints, which tell stories of tradition and heritage.
3. Jewelry and Adornments
African jewelry is renowned for its bold designs and use of colorful beads and natural materials. From necklaces and bracelets to earrings and rings, these pieces often carry symbolic meanings and are perfect for those looking to make a fashion statement.
4. Home Decor
Enhance your living space with unique African home decor items, such as masks, wall hangings, and handmade pottery. These pieces not only add character to your home but also serve as conversation starters.
5. Culinary Delights
For food enthusiasts, African grocery stores offer a treasure trove of spices, sauces, and ingredients essential for preparing authentic African dishes. Discover unique flavors and cooking methods that will elevate your culinary repertoire.
The Cultural Significance of African Treasures
Each item found in African shops carries cultural significance and tells a story. For example, traditional textiles often represent a person's status, achievements, or heritage. Similarly, sculptures and masks may have spiritual or ceremonial purposes. By purchasing these items, customers not only acquire unique treasures but also contribute to the preservation of African culture and support local artisans.
